A letter from Tom Barry, 64 St. Patrick’s Street, Cork, to Bartholmew ‘Batt’ Murphy, referring to an event organised by the West Cork Michael Collins Memorial Committee held in Collins’s birthplace of Sam’s Cross near Clonakilty in County Cork. Barry writes ‘The crowd was enormous; the weather kindly and best of all was the sight of hundreds of the veterans, divided by the civil strife, marching together once more’. He adds ‘Even during the Civil War, I spoke of Mick’s great services to Ireland, and I paid him the same tribute in “Guerrilla Days in Ireland”. I only acted and spoke as I saw the truth about the man’.
